Details of Turkmenistan Fiber Optic Communication

Article Overview

Turkmenistan is rapidly expanding its optical fiber network, aiming to enhance national connectivity and international transit capacity while supporting digital transformation across all sectors.

National Fiber-Optic Infrastructure

Turkmenistan's fiber-optic backbone forms the core of its digital infrastructure, connecting major cities, industrial facilities, and cross-border links with neighboring countries. The network consists of high-capacity underground optical cables, optical cross-connects, communication nodes, and data centers, supporting voice communication, mobile internet, corporate networks, banking systems, telemedicine, and e-government services . This backbone is critical for industrial control systems, pipeline transport, rail logistics, customs, and banking settlements, making it a cornerstone of the national economy .

International Connectivity

Currently, Turkmenistan is connected to eight international fiber-optic networks, with plans to expand to eleven by 2028 . Key projects include:

  • Serhetabat – Herat via Arkadagyň Ak ýoly: A cross-border line enhancing transit traffic and providing access to the Indian telecommunications market .
  • Submarine fiber-optic cable with Azerbaijan: Laid along the Caspian Sea by Turkmentelekom and Azertelekom to strengthen regional connectivity .
  • Terrestrial trunk lines: Routes such as Etrek–Incheburun and Bekdash–Temirbaba are under construction to improve international data transmission capacity . These projects position Turkmenistan as a strategic information and communications bridge between East and West, as well as North and South in Central Asia .

Coverage and Digital Transformation

Turkmenistan has achieved 100% high-speed internet coverage across all settlements, leveraging a combination of satellite, mobile, and fixed-line technologies . The country's digital transformation initiatives include building data centers, cloud computing infrastructure, smart cities like Arkadag, and integrating ICT solutions into healthcare, education, and government services . These efforts are part of broader state programs for 2026–2028, emphasizing technological sovereignty and economic resilience .

Strategic Importance

The expansion of fiber-optic networks not only enhances domestic connectivity but also increases transit traffic capacity, enabling Turkmenistan to participate in international internet traffic and regional IT markets . This infrastructure supports economic diversification beyond traditional commodities, strengthens cybersecurity, and lays the foundation for advanced digital services and smart city ecosystems . In summary, Turkmenistan's optical fiber communication network is a key enabler of national digital transformation, international connectivity, and economic modernization, with ongoing projects set to significantly expand both domestic and cross-border capabilities by 2028 .
